My IHI/Borg Warner RHC6 GM-1 has a 51mm inducer and a 70mm exducer on the compressor side. I was told the exhaust wheel was similar in size to a gt30 wheel. Both housings are .70a/r with the compressor being 3"inlet, 2.5" outlet and the turbine housing is undivided t3. I believe that all the gm...

They never really discontinued the td series turbos. Evo 4-9 is a td05hr. R meaning reverse rotation. Same goes for the srt-4 turbos. Theres still plenty of td series turbos out there.
Hook the black hose into the compressor cover. Then hook the bov directly to the intake manifold. The way you have it setup wont let the wastegate open hence the unlimited boost situation. Try adjusting the mbc once you hook it up the right way.
For a mbc your not supposed to tee into the bov. Hook it up to the compressor housing then adjust it. Hook up the wastegate to the compressor housing then proceed from there. Then hook up the mbc and adjust it.
